Coordinator for the ‘From Words to Action’ project
The coordinator will support the development and piloting of a self-assessment tool enabling NTD organisations to gain more understanding of the gaps and challenges that exist in relation to inclusion and participation of persons affected by neglected tropical diseases (NTDs).
Background
It has been widely recognised that the active participation of persons affected by NTDs in the policies and decision-making processes of NTD NGOs is of vital importance, however this is not always a reality. It was concluded that it is time now for a more structured way to boost inclusion and participation in our organisations and measure the progress that is being made. A start was made with the development of a self-assessment tool that can be used by NTD organisations, NTD inclusion score card (NISC). The opportunity was given by the International Federation of Anti-Leprosy Associations (ILEP) to further develop the NISC and pilot the tool over a period of one year through the From Words to Action project.
What will you do as coordinator?
The coordinator (employee or consultancy-based) will work with NLR, other NTD NGOs and the broader NNN DMDI cross-cutting group to support the finalising process of the NISC. This includes the technical development of the tool, as well as coordination of 10 pilots in NTD organisations. The coordinator will be responsible for the day-to-day project coordination, including project planning, budget keeping, relationship building and collaboration with all involved organisations, communication, and reporting. In addition to some face-to-face meetings, most work will take place in an online environment.
